What is the US Gift Tax Return Instructions 2002?

The US Gift Tax Return Instructions 2002 refer to the guidelines associated with IRS Form 709, which serves the purpose of reporting gifts made during the 2002 calendar year. This form is crucial for taxpayers who provide financial transfers to others exceeding the annual exclusion limits, thereby ensuring compliance with federal tax laws. The instructions, meticulously provided by the IRS, offer detailed guidance on how to accurately complete Form 709, emphasizing its significance in the realm of gift taxation.

Taxpayers who have made gifts exceeding the annual exclusion amount to any individual in 2002 are required to file the US Gift Tax Return, also known as IRS Form 709.
The US Gift Tax Return for gifts made in 2002 should have been filed by April 15, 2003. If you miss this deadline, you may incur penalties.
You can submit IRS Form 709 by mail, sending it directly to the appropriate IRS address based on your location. Some taxpayers may also have electronic filing options available.
You should include any supporting documents that provide information on gifted assets or details relating to the gifts, such as appraisals or written agreements if applicable.
Common mistakes include not reporting all gifts, incorrect valuation of gifts, and missing signatures. Ensure all relevant fields are completed thoroughly to avoid issues.
Processing times can vary, but generally, you can expect the IRS to review and process Form 709 within several weeks to a few months, depending on the volume of submissions.
No, notarization is not required for filing the US Gift Tax Return (Form 709). Ensure accuracy and completeness instead.
